“A blistering romp of rock'n'roll carnage” Single Review: Fickle Public - Barfly Club on 24/01/06 - Just Like I Got Used To Saying Courteney Cox Arquette

From Metro Scotland, by Doug Johnstone on 24 January 2006

There's nothing like a catchy song title and Just Like I Got Used to Saying Courteney Cox Arquette is nothing like a catchy song title. Still, that doesn't seem to bother post-hardcore punksters Fickle Public - and nor should it, considering the song is a blistering romp of rock'n'roll carnage.

The track looks set to launch the Elgin/Glasgow four-piece (previously known as Purple Munkie) into the nation's consciousness. Perhaps 2006 will be the year when everything finally comes together for them - as well as these gigs (part of a Kerrang!-sponsored tour), their debut album, Bucko, is scheduled for release in mid-February.
